A printed circuit board pcb mechanically supports and electrically connects electrical or electronic components using conductive tracks, pads and other features etched from one or more sheet layers of copper laminated onto andor between sheet layers of a nonconductive substrate. Mechanical cad software packages are able to generate a dxf or dwg file which contains the required data to produce a pcb, however, the dxf or dwg format is not preferred by pcb manufacturers due to the extra time required to interpret these files and.
